As mentioned in my other post, I've been comparing my old center channel to my new one. I chalk up the sound differences between the 2 speakers to the tweeters...the PSB is a 1/2" poly-flare dome with ferrofluid. My mains(also PSB) are 1"treated textile dome dome with ferrofluid . The Axiom has two 1" titanium tweeters. Can you elaborate on tweeter differences and advantages and disadvantages of each type. What made you decide to use Titanium?

The underlying premise behind the use of metal diaphragms for both the woofers and tweeters is that the diaphragm will not distort in any way during use, especially at high volume.
